Authorities in South Africa should lift a suspension of use of the Johnson & Johnson Covid-19 vaccine if a number of conditions are met, the country’s health regulator has announced.
South African Health Products Regulatory Authority (SAHPRA) said it had “recommended that the pause in the Sisonke study be lifted, provided that specific conditions are met”, referring to the clinical trial that allows Pretoria to make the single dose J&J vaccine available to healthcare workers.
